After further review of both tickets it appears response times on both tickets and all responses was within a reasonable amount of time and with accurate responses. The main issue on your account(which appears to be ongoing) is that your scripts are running for an excessive amount of time and upon strace'ing these processes they are just hanging in an flock state attempting to lock or perform a file lock operation which never appears to complete. Further investigation of the script source itself indicates the script is dated back to 2005 and is quite outdated and I would recommend upgrading this to a more recent version of the script to try and resolve this issue. I don't see any issues with the server itself nor are any other customers on this machine experiencing any similar issues so I'm pretty certain this is isolated to the script installation on this domain.

Also I see that you began having issues after the move to PHP5 on this server which may be related. We can place .htaccess directives in place that will revert you to PHP4 on this server if you'd like to try that to see if any different behavior occurs. We run into these sorts of problems with outdated scripts a lot. They are often buggy and are often tough on servers in regards to the number and intensity of processes they use. They haven't been optimized, which is why you're running into the problems that you're running into.

Without us going in and recoding the script to make it efficient, the solutions we're offering (killing processes, etc.) are the simplest and most reliable ways to fix the problems at hand.
